Recipient of the NCRLL Distinguished Researcher Award, KARIN DAHL is a professor at The Ohio State University, where she teaches in the language, literature, and culture section, and focuses on language arts and children's writing.PATRICIA SCHARER is an associate professor at The Ohio State University, where her research focuses on classroom use of children's literature and early literacy instruction.An assistant professor at Wittenburg University, LORA LAWSON teaches courses in literacy, arts integration, and early childhood education.PATRICIA GROGAN is an assistant professor at the University of Dayton, where she teaches at the undergraduate and graduate levels in the areas of reading, phonics, and intervention techniques.
